Alarming Signs
You can find out that your basement or foundation needs immediate repair by these signs:
·         Cracked brickwork on the exterior of your home
·         Water damage and fungus growth even after basement waterproofing
·         Door and window frames out of square
·         Visible cracks in interior basement walls or floor

Various Procedures of Repair
Basement waterproofing can involve a variety of setups. You might have a to contact a basement and a Concrete Contractor in Kansas City to install an inner or outer foundation layer to keep away the water from entering inside. The contractors can also make a French drain and sump pump to make the water out of the space. They also suggest you to use a dehumidifier to vanish the moisture from the air. But none of these are the sufficient methods that are proven to be effective if your foundation remains cracked and worsening.
